Code: Alles auswählen
root@debian /etc/openvpn > /etc/init.d/openvpn restart
[ ok ] Stopping virtual private network daemon:.
[....] Starting virtual private network daemon: serverstart-stop-daemon: --start needs --exec or --startas
Try 'start-stop-daemon --help' for more information.
failed!
Code: Alles auswählen
mode server
port 55194
proto udp
dev tap0
ca /etc/openvpn/easy-rsa/keys/ca.crt
cert /etc/openvpn/easy-rsa/keys/debian.crt
key /etc/openvpn/easy-rsa/keys/debian.key
dh /etc/openvpn/easy-rsa/keys/dh1024.pem
#crl-verify /etc/openvpn/easy-rsa/keys/crl.pem
tls-server
ifconfig 10.8.0.1 255.255.255.0
push "route-gateway 10.8.0.1"
push "route 192.168.11.0 255.255.255.0"
max-clients 30
#server-bridge 192.168.11.3 255.255.255.0 192.168.11.200 192.168.11.300
ifconfig-pool 10.8.0.150 10.8.0.180
push "route 10.8.0.0 255.255.255.0"
client-to-client
push "dhcp-option DNS 192.168.11.1"
tun-mtu 1500
mssfix
verb 3
#cipher BF-CBC
comp-lzo
keepalive 10 120
status /var/log/openvpn.status.log
#chroot /tmp/openvpn
#user openvpn
#group openvpn
log /var/log/openvpn.log
bridge-start
Code: Alles auswählen
#!/bin/bash
#################################
# Set up Ethernet bridge on Linux
# Requires: bridge-utils
#################################
# Define Bridge Interface
br="br0"
# Define list of TAP interfaces to be bridged,
# for example tap="tap0 tap1 tap2".
tap="tap0"
# Define physical ethernet interface to be bridged
# with TAP interface(s) above.
eth="eth0"
eth_ip="192.168.11.3"
eth_netmask="255.255.255.0"
eth_broadcast="192.168.11.255"
for t in $tap; do
openvpn --mktun --dev $t
done
brctl addbr $br
brctl addif $br $eth
for t in $tap; do
brctl addif $br $t
done
for t in $tap; do
ifconfig $t 0.0.0.0 promisc up
done
ifconfig $eth 0.0.0.0 promisc up
ifconfig $br $eth_ip netmask $eth_netmask broadcast $eth_broadcast
route add default gw 192.168.11.1